Vocal UDA Senator has broken silence after Meru Governor, Kawira Mwangaza was impeached by Meru MCAs. The impeachment motion against Governor Kawira Mwagaza was tabled at the Assembly on Wednesday morning. 67 out of 69 Members of the County Assembly of Meru voted yes to the Impeachment Motion tabled by Hon. DMK Kiogora Member for Abogeta West and Minority Party Whip.
"Honourable members, I wish to declare that the Governor of Meru Hon. Bishop Kawira Mwangaza stands impeached by the Meru County Assembly," Speaker Ayub Bundi Solomon said. Within seven days, Speaker Amason Kingi is expected to convene the house for a sitting to hear Mwagaza's impeachment charges.
UDA Senator, Arap Cherargei has now stated that the Senate is obliged to listen to charges against Governor Kawira Mwangaza and decide whether to hold the impeachment or vote against it. He has further told Gov. Kawira that current Court cases filed on the impeachment cannot stop senators from deliberating on the impeachment motion.
